The trailer of Abhishek Bachchan-starrer slice-of-life film I Want To Talk was released on Tuesday. Directed by Shoojit Sircar, the film’s screenplay and dialogues have been penned by Ritesh Shah.

As per the over two minutes trailer, Abhishek plays a character suffering from a serious disease, but we are never told exactly what. As he prepares for a life-altering surgery, he goes on a journey to make amends with those he has miffed. “The purpose of this story is for me to say sorry to those I have hurt,” he says in a voiceover. Abhishek’s character also has a daughter with whom he has strained relations.

The film also features Ahilya Bamroo, Johnny Lever and Jayant Kripalani, among others.

I Want To Talk marks the first collaboration between Abhishek and Shoojit. The latter has frequently teamed up with Abhishek's father, superstar Amitabh Bachchan, on films like Piku and Gulabo Sitabo. Shoojit's last film was the patriotic-thriller Sardar Udham

Earlier, talking about the film with PTI, the director had said, "It's a very simple observation of life with a little smile. When I watch the film, its post-production, it brings a smile (to my face). And, I can guarantee that it is one of the finest of Abhishek Bachchan films. We always wanted to work together but we were not getting the right kind of script."

The film will release in theatres on November 22.
